Buying Guide: Key Considerations When Purchasing a Ft-Lb Torque Wrench
- Drive size and torque range: Most common are 1/2″ and 3/4″ drives. Match the range to your typical fasteners and equipment. Bigger ranges expand versatility but may affect size and weight.
- Calibration and accuracy: Look for models with ISO or ASME standards, traceable calibration certificates, and a stated accuracy percentage. Regular recalibration ensures ongoing precision.
- Readability and scale: Dual-range scales and high-contrast markings help you set torque accurately, especially in low-light environments. Micrometer or digital readouts provide quick, repeatable adjustments.
- Build quality and durability: Hardened steel, chrome vanadium components, and corrosion-resistant finishes extend tool life in demanding settings. A robust carrying case aids portability and storage.
- Locking and release features: Quick-lock or detent mechanisms simplify setting changes. A reliable release ensures you can reset without tool damage.
- Direction and compatibility: Bi-directional wrenches are essential for versatile torque applications. Ensure the wrench is suitable for your project’s direction needs.
- Maintenance needs: Some models require routine calibration checks; consider how easy it is to service or send in for calibration when needed.
- Digital versus analog: Digital wrenches offer presets and data logging but may require batteries and careful handling. Analog or click-type wrenches provide simplicity and reliability in harsh environments.
